What is the KSM137 best suited to?

Recommended applications include the close-miking of acoustic and electric instruments, drum overheads, brass/woodwind, ensembles, and even bass instruments such as double bass and kick drum. The KSM137 is equally at home in the studio or in live applications.
What characteristics can I expect when using a KSM137?

The KSM137 microphone can withstand extremely high sound pressure levels (SPL). It has a high output level, low self noise and reproduces low frequency sounds exceptionally well.

A highly consistent cardioid polar pattern
Ultra-thin, 2.5 micron, 24 karat gold-layered, low mass Mylar® diaphragm for superior transient response
Class A, discrete, transformerless preamplifier for transparency, extremely fast transient response, no crossover distortion, and minimal harmonic distortion
Premium electronic components, including gold-plated internal and external connectors
Subsonic filter eliminates low frequency rumble (less than 17 Hz) caused by mechanical vibration
Three-position switchable pad (0 dB, 15 dB, and 25 dB) for handling extremely high sound pressure levels (SPLs)
Three-position switchable low-frequency filter reduces background noise and counteracts proximity effect
